28 DECEMBER 2017 • WORLD AQUACULTURE • WWW.WAS.ORG In the rice-fish system using a refuge with a peripheral trench system, an on-farm trial was conducted in Kyrdem village to assess the growth of common carp in a rice-fish system with an area of 0.17 ha divided into two plots. Fish in one plot were provided with supplementary feed and fish in the other plot were not fed. The field was prepared using a refuge system with a peripheral trench and a central cross-trench. In the rice-fish culture system without a peripheral trench system, an on-farm trial was conducted in four villages of Ri-Bhoi district (Kyrdem, Sohrublei, Mawtneng, Nongthamai) to assess the growth of common carp in a rice-fish culture system with an area of 0.5 ha among five farmers. The rice field had a refuge and a central cross-trench, but no peripheral trench. Rice-Fish Management The plots used for rice-fish culture were planted with the Shashrang rice variety (Fig. 5) and were fertilized with cow dung at 3000 kg/ha per month. Fish were fed with a mixture of rice bran and mustard oil cake at a ratio of 1:1, made twice daily (morning and evening) and applied by broadcasting. Fish were fed at a daily rate of 3 percent of total fish body weight. Common carp fingerlings with an average weight of 2.5-3.0 g and average length of 5 cm at a density of 4000/ha were stocked into rice fields 21 days after transplantation of rice seedlings (Fig. 6). A border fence of nylon mesh was erected to prevent fish escape during heavy rains. A daily water level maintenance check was done and sampling was conducted monthly to monitor fish growth and health status (Fig. 7). No chemical insecticides or pesticides were applied during the rearing period. To harvest fish, water was drained through the outlet pipe, thus allowing fish and water to accumulate in the central channel of the rice field. Fish were then easily caught with a hand net (Fig. 8).
